Why spend money on a dolls house when you can create your own from your recycling!


Material

  • 1 Cardboard box
  • 1 Scissors
  • 1 Stickytape
  • 2 Toilet rolls
  • Various Tissue papers
  • Various Permanent markers and pencils
  • 2 Small balls of wool for fairy hair

Method

  1. Dismantle a wine box and fashion into the shape of a dolls house using tape and scissors.
  2. Cut in details like windows and a door..
  3. Decorate the house. I used wrapping paper to line the internal walls and sgarpies and pencils to decorate the outside. Let the kids decorate!
  4. Create fairies by adding facial features, sticky tape wool for hair and cut and tape on tissue paper wings and dresses.
  5. Have fun playing with it all! Create a whole village and more fairies to keep the fun going.
